Essential Ingredients for Tater Tot Breakfast Casserole
To make this tater tot breakfast casserole, you’ll need a few key items that create its signature cheesy and savory appeal. Start with high-quality frozen tater tots for the crispy base, and choose proteins like ham for a hearty touch. These ingredients come together easily to form a crowd-pleasing dish that’s simple yet delicious.
- 1 bag (30-32 ounces) of frozen tater tots
- 16 ounces of diced ham (which can be substituted with cooked and crumbled bacon, breakfast sausage, or omitted for a vegetarian option using beans or vegetables)
- 1 ½ cups of shredded cheddar cheese
- 1 cup of shredded mozzarella or Monterey Jack cheese
- 8 large eggs
- ½ cup of sour cream (full fat recommended)
- 1 cup of milk
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½ teaspoon pepper
- ½ teaspoon garlic powder
- ½ teaspoon onion powder
- 1-2 teaspoons of hot sauce (optional)

How to Prepare the Perfect Tater Tot Breakfast Casserole: Step-by-Step Guide
Getting this tater tot breakfast casserole right starts with prepping your ingredients and oven. Begin by heating your oven to 375°F, which ensures even baking without drying out the dish. This method combines simple steps for a foolproof result every time.
- Preheat your oven to 375°F and grease a baking dish to avoid sticking.
- In a large bowl, whisk together 8 large eggs, 1 cup of milk, ½ cup of sour cream, ½ teaspoon salt, ½ teaspoon pepper, ½ teaspoon garlic powder, and ½ teaspoon onion powder until smooth.
- Layer the 16 ounces of diced ham and cheeses (1 ½ cups shredded cheddar and 1 cup shredded mozzarella) at the bottom of the dish.
- Pour the egg mixture evenly over the ham and cheese layers.
- Arrange the 1 bag (30-32 ounces) of frozen tater tots on top for a crispy finish.
- Bake for about 45 minutes until set, then add extra cheddar on top and bake for 5 more minutes until melted.
- Let the casserole cool slightly before serving to help it hold its shape.

How to Store Tater Tot Breakfast Casserole: Best Practices
Proper storage keeps your tater tot breakfast casserole fresh and tasty for days. Store leftovers in the fridge in airtight containers to lock in flavors. Freezing portions ahead makes it simple for meal prep on busy weeks.
- Refrigerate for up to 3-4 days in sealed containers.
- Freeze for up to 2 months in freezer-safe bags.
- Reheat in the oven at 350°F to keep the crispiness intact.

FAQs: Frequently Asked Questions About Tater Tot Breakfast Casserole
Can I prepare Tater Tot Breakfast Casserole the night before?
Yes, you can prepare the casserole the night before. Simply assemble it without baking, cover it tightly, and refrigerate for up to 12 hours. When ready, bake it directly from the fridge, adding a few extra minutes to the cooking time. This method saves time on busy mornings and allows the flavors to meld.
What are good substitutions for ingredients in Tater Tot Breakfast Casserole?
You can swap regular ground sausage for turkey sausage or bacon for a leaner option. For dairy, use shredded cheese alternatives or plant-based milk in place of cream. If you want a vegetarian version, replace sausage with sautéed vegetables like mushrooms and bell peppers. Adjust seasoning as needed to maintain flavor.
How long should I bake a Tater Tot Breakfast Casserole?
Bake the casserole at 350°F (175°C) for 45 to 50 minutes, or until the Tater Tots are golden brown and a knife inserted into the center comes out clean. Baking time may vary slightly depending on your oven and the casserole’s depth, so check at 40 minutes to avoid overcooking.
Can I freeze Tater Tot Breakfast Casserole for later use?
Yes, you can freeze the casserole either baked or unbaked. For best results, bake it first, let it cool completely, then wrap it tightly in foil or plastic wrap before freezing. When ready to eat, thaw overnight in the refrigerator and reheat in the oven at 350°F (175°C) until heated through, about 25-30 minutes.
